Abstract

The invention discloses a wireless remote monitoring system for a solar heat collection device, comprising a solar heat collection PLC control system, a singlechip GSM controller and a singlechip Ethernet controller, wherein the singlechip GSM controller and the singlechip Ethernet controller are in bidirectional connection with the solar heat collection PLC control system respectively; and the solar heat collection PLC control system is connected with the solar heat collection device. The system has a reasonable structure, can effectively realize automatic control and network management on the solar heat collection device, can reflect monitor interface, database, dynamic data, historical data, dynamic curve and monitoring information of the solar heat collection device on site in real time, and can adjust the running status of the solar heat collection device remotely and set the running parameter of the device.

Background technology
At present, domestic solar water heater mainly is installed on resident's the roof with the form of separate unit, along with the execution of national economizing energy law and regenerative resource method, increasing public building such as school, hotel, hospital, army's barracks etc. are forced to install solar water heater.This just need be for large-area solar water heating system provides the automaticity height, and easy to use, Operation and Maintenance does not need the supervisory system of higher professional technique.Existing supervisory system all is fixed, and complex structure is unreasonable, and monitoring is disturbed by extraneous factor easily.

Embodiment
Be elaborated below in conjunction with the technical scheme of accompanying drawing to invention:
As shown in Figure 1, wireless remote monitoring system for solar heat collection device of the present invention, comprise solar energy heating PLC control system, single-chip microcomputer GSM controller and single-chip microcomputer ethernet controller, wherein single-chip microcomputer GSM controller and single-chip microcomputer ethernet controller respectively with two-way connection of solar energy heating PLC control system, solar energy heating PLC control system is connected with solar energy heat collector.
As shown in Figure 2, described single-chip microcomputer GSM controller is connected in series serial line interface SC11, data analysis processing module, serial line interface SC12 and the 2nd RS232 translation interface successively by a RS232 translation interface and constitutes.
Preferably, described single-chip microcomputer GSM controller also is provided with GSM SMS module controller, and described GSM SMS module controller is connected with single-chip microcomputer GSM controller.
Solar energy heat collector is made up of many groups connection in series-parallel heat collector, attemperater, assisted heating device, pipeline and booster body, temperature and pressure sensor etc., is mainly used in the place of enterprises and institutions (hotel, school, hospital etc.) central heating.Solar energy heat collector has solar energy heating performance efficiently.
Field control system is a solar energy heating PLC control system, and signals such as the each point temperature of collection heat collector, hydraulic pressure, water level are handled through field control system, operations such as each topworks of control solar energy heat collector such as pump, valve, auxiliary heating; Can set the period of supplying water on demand; Solar energy heat collector has functions such as instant-heating, constant voltage constant temperature, antifreeze, anti-bombing, fault self-diagnosis.
Field control system also with the operation information of solar energy heat collector and detect data, comprises each topworks's real-time working state, reaches recent data, alarm logging etc. in real time; Thermal-arrest process to solar energy heat collector adopts Hybrid Control.
GSM SMS module controller has by the SMS realization the remote inquiry of the service data of solar energy heat collector and the remote control function of running status; The SMS order, fuzzy diagnosis, Based Intelligent Control.During the solar energy heat collector fault, send to the mobile phone of user's appointment by gsm module.
The field control system of system of the present invention adopts advanced mixed control method, realizes the intellectuality control of solar energy heat collector, has intelligent control function such as anti-overheated, constant pressure water supply, degerming, automatic desludging, antifreeze, anti-bombing; Can analyze the trouble spot and the reason thereof of solar energy heat collector automatically.
The GSM SMS module controller of system of the present invention has by the SMS realization the remote inquiry of the service data of solar energy heat collector and the remote control function of running status; The SMS order, fuzzy diagnosis, Based Intelligent Control.During the solar energy heat collector fault, send to the mobile phone of user's appointment by gsm module.
